MITP is a hybrid capital security, not common stock.
This listing is a capital note, preference share, or similar instrument associated with TPG Mortgage Investment Trust Inc 9.500% Senior Notes due 2029. Data providers report company-level figures against it, so fundamentals, valuation multiples, and dividend history on this page describe the issuing company — not this instrument — and its market capitalization cannot be computed reliably, so it is not shown. The quoted price is the instrument's own.

TPG Mortgage Investment Trust Inc functions as a Real Estate Investment Trust (REIT). The company's primary objective is to acquire, manage, and invest in a broad portfolio of what it terms 'target assets,' which include residential mortgage assets, other real estate-related securities, and various financial instruments. A significant portion of its investments also targets residential mortgage-backed securities (RMBS) that are either issued or guaranteed by a government-sponsored enterprise (GSE).
